Description

The Times Hotel in Amsterdam is a 3-star hotel in a historic building on the 'Herengracht'. As part of the international hotel group World Hotels, the Times Hotel guarantees a unique location, comfortable rooms, and good service from a professional staff. The hotel is located in a centuries old canal house that was built in 1650 and completely renovated in 2006. The hotel features 33 rooms, each of which is comfortably furnished and colourfully decorated. Each room is equipped with double or twin beds, a toilet, shower and/or bath, a telephone, a broadband Internet connection, and an LCD television. In addition, each room is equipped with air conditioning.

The Times Hotel has much more to offer its guests besides the standard amenities. The hotel has a rapid dry-cleaning service and at an additional charge guests can make use of the sauna, only a 2 minute walk from the hotel. You will be able to buy tickets for excursions and city tours from the helpful reception staff. Reception can also provide you with any information with regards to tourist, cultural or culinary queries. Every morning guests can enjoy a delicious breakfast buffet, and you can enjoy a drink in the pleasant hotel bar.

The hotel offers not only a gorgeous appearance and good service, it also offers its guest an ideal location in the city centre of Amsterdam. For example, the hotel is a mere 500 metre away from the 'Anne Frank Huis', an essential destination for any visitor to the city of Amsterdam. The 'Dam', the famous site of the Royal Palace, the War Monument, and Madame Tussauds, is also merely 400 metre away from the Times Hotel. Those who prefer shopping will appreciate the hotel's close proximity to the 'Bijenkorf' department store and the many shops on the famous 'Kalverstraat'. Furthermore, the hotel?s direct surroundings are perfectly suited for a memorable exploration of Amsterdam?s famous ring of canals, with its many bridges, canals, and stately historic buildings.

Surroundings

The Times Hotel has a view of the famous 'Herengracht', a street on the west side of Amsterdam?s famous ring of canals. As such, the hotel is very close to the 'Anne Frank Huis' and the many attractions and shopping centres of the city centre. The 'Dam' (the site of the Royal Palace) and Amsterdam Central Station are within walking distance of the hotel, and so is the area that may be Amsterdam?s most world-famous attraction: the Red Light District.
